crypto
Enables digital certificate configuration and RSA Keypair
management. Digital certificates are issued by CAs and contain
user or device specific information, such as name, public key,
IP address, serial number, company name etc. Use this command to
generate, delete, export, or import encrypted RSA Keypairs and
generate CSR (Certificate Signing Request).

Note
This command and its syntax is common to both the User
Executable and Privilege
Executable configuration modes.

crypto key zeroize rsa <RSA-KEYPAIR-NAME> {force} {(on <DEVICE-NAME>)}
key
|
Enables RSA Keypair management. Use this
command to export, import, generate, or
delete a RSA key.
|
zeroize rsa <RSA-KEYPAIR-NAME>
|
Deletes a specified RSA Keypair
Note:
All device certificates associated with
this key will also be deleted.
|
force
|
Optional. Forces deletion of all certificates
associated with the specified RSA Keypair.
Optionally specify a device on which to
force certificate deletion.
|

crypto pki export request [generate-rsa-key|short [generate-rsa-key|use-rsa-key]|use-rsa-key] <RSA-KEYPAIR-NAME> subject-name <COMMON-NAME> <COUNTRY> <STATE> <CITY> <ORGANIZATION> <ORGANIZATION-UNIT> (<EXPORT-TO-URL>,email <SEND-TO-EMAIL>,fqdn <FQDN>,ip-address <IP>)
pki
|
Enables PKI management. Use this command to
authenticate, export, generate, or delete a
trustpoint and its associated CA
certificates.
|
export request
|
Exports CSR to the CA for a digital identity
certificate. The CSR contains applicant‘s
details and RSA Keypair‘s public key.
|
[generate-rsa-key| short
[generate-rsa-key|use-rsa-key]| use-rsa-key]
<RSA-KEYPAIR-NAME>
|
Generates a new RSA Keypair or uses an
existing RSA Keypair
-
generate-rsa-key – Generates a new
RSA Keypair for digital
authentication
-
short [generate-rsa-key|use-rsa-key]
– Generates and exports a shorter
version of the CSR
-
generate-rsa-key – Generates a new
RSA Keypair for digital authentication.
If generating a new RSA Keypair, specify
a name for it.
-
use-rsa-key – Uses an existing RSA
Keypair for digital authentication. If
using an existing RSA Keypair, specify
its name.
-
use-rsa-key – Uses an existing RSA
Keypair for digital authentication
|
subject-name <COMMON-NAME>
|
Configures a subject name, defined by the
<COMMON-NAME> keyword, to identify the
certificate
|
<COUNTRY>
|
Sets the deployment country code (2 character
ISO code)
|
<STATE>
|
Sets the state name (2 to 64 characters in
length)
|
<CITY>
|
Sets the city name (2 to 64 characters in
length)
|
<ORGANIZATION>
|
Sets the organization name (2 to 64
characters in length)
|
<ORGANIZATION-UNIT>
|
Sets the organization unit (2 to 64
characters in length)
|
<EXPORT-TO-URL>
|
Specify the CA‘s location. Both IPv4 and IPv6
address formats are supported. The CSR is
exported to the specified location.
|
email <SEND-TO-EMAIL>
|
Exports CSR to a specified e-mail address
|
fqdn <FQDN>
|
Exports CSR to a specified FQDN
|
ip-address <IP>
|
Exports CSR to a specified device or system
|

Usage
Guidelines
The system supports both IPv4 and IPv6 address formats. Provide
source and destination locations using any one of the following
options:
-
IPv4 URLs:
tftp://<hostname|IPv4>[:port]/path/file
ftp://<user>:<passwd>@<hostname|IPv4>[:port]/path/file
sftp://<user>@<hostname|IPv4>[:port]>/path/file
http://<hostname|IPv4>[:port]/path/file
cf:/path/file
usb<n>:/path/file
-
IPv6 URLs:
tftp://<hostname|IPv6>[:port]/path/file
ftp://<user>:<passwd>@<hostname|IPv6>[:port]/path/file
sftp://<user>@<hostname|IPv6>[:port]>/path/file
http://<hostname|IPv6>[:port]/path/file
Examples
ap510-133B3B#crypto key generate rsa local 2048 on ap510-133B3B
RSA Keypair successfully generated
ap510-133B3B#
